Title: Backstage Wife Type: Drama, Soap Opera, Melodrama Broadcast History: Aug 5, 1935-Mar 27, 1936 Mutual. 15m, continuation, weekdays at 9:45am. Sterling Drugs Mar 30, 1936-Jul 1, 1955 NBC. 15m weekday mornings initially, then at 4:15. Then beginning in Sept 1936 a 19-year run at 4:00. Sterling Drugs for Dr.Lyons Tooth Powder; Proctor & Gamble as of mid-1951. Jul 4, 1955-Jan 2, 1959 CBS. 15m, weekdays at 12:15. Multiple sponsorship Cast: Mary Nobel Vivian Fridell, Claire Niesen Larry Noble Ken Griffin, James Meighan, Guy Sorel Larry’s Mother Ethel Owen Dramatic story of the wife of a major Broadway star. Coming from a small town to the big city and Mary marries a Broadway star. She then endures everything that could be used in a Soap Opera, from scheming starlets and wannabes trying to take her man to misunderstandings, jealousy, hatred and even murder.
